Staff Software QA Engineer
Lead quality engineering efforts for a Linux-based wireless IoT platform, driving both functional and non-functional validation strategies across device, system, and cloud layers.
Act as a technical leader and subject matter expert in quality engineering, influencing product architecture, test strategy, and release readiness. Collaborate cross-functionally with engineering, product, and operations teams to ensure scalable, reliable, and high-quality system delivery.
Leverage modern AI-assisted techniques to improve test design, automation, defect detection, and quality insights. Champion best practices in test automation, observability, and continuous quality.
Essential Job Functions:
- Drive quality engineering strategy across features and releases.
- Influence system architecture to improve testability, reliability, and observability.
- Mentor engineers and elevate QE practices across the organization.
- Lead cross-team defect triage, root cause analysis, and quality improvement initiatives.
- Define metrics, dashboards, and KPIs for product quality.
- Design, develop, maintain, and execute test cases and test plans at functional and system levels.
- Perform black and gray box testing of released products and products under development to reveal design and implementation defects.
- Understand the focus of functional, system, integration and regression testing at feature and system levels.
- Use test tools such as debuggers, emulators, and simulators to compliment testing.
- Use bug tracking systems to track the life cycle of bugs.
- Develop and maintain quality engineering processes and initiatives.
- Identify automation opportunities, develop and maintain automated tests.
- Analyze test results, troubleshoot and triage issues cross team to perform root cause analysis and resolution.
- Collaborate with developers, product managers & QA engineers to complete assigned tasks.
- Evangelize software testing best practices and influence architecture.
- Define and execute non-functional testing strategies, including performance, scalability, reliability, and resilience testing.
- Validate system behavior under stress, fault injection, and recovery scenarios.
- Evaluate system power consumption, resource usage, and platform efficiency for embedded Linux environments.

Qualifications:
Education:
Bachelor's/Master's degree in Computer Science, Electrical Engineering, or related fields.
Experience:
7+ years of experience in Quality Assurance/Engineering, preferably in embedded systems, IoT, or audio technologies.
- Experience with services and protocol testing working with HTTP/JSON/Rest APIs.
- Experience with Linux-based systems and wireless technologies (Wi-Fi, Bluetooth, audio codecs).
- Hands-on experience designing and coding automated tests in scripting languages like Python.
- Hands-on experience in developing test automation with frameworks such as Playwright and Postman.
- Experience working closely with development teams in an Agile software development workplace.
- Experience with project, test and knowledge management tools such as Jira, Xray, and Confluence.
- Excellent oral and written communication skills.
- Excellent analytical, problem solving, planning and organizing skills.
- Experience with non-functional testing tools (performance, load, chaos testing).
- Experience with CI/CD pipelines and quality gates.
- Experience with observability tools (logs, metrics, tracing).
- Familiarity with IoT protocols (e.g., MQTT, RTP, SIP) (optional but valuable).
- Experience applying AI tools in software development or testing workflows.
- Proven ability to lead cross-functional initiatives without direct authority.
